What is Pakistani Rupee (PKR)

The Pakistani Rupee (PKR) is the official currency of Pakistan. It is subdivided into 100 paisas, although paisas are rarely used in everyday transactions. The symbol for the Pakistani Rupee is ₨, and its ISO code is PKR. The currency is issued and regulated by the State Bank of Pakistan.

The value of the Pakistani Rupee can fluctuate due to various factors, including economic performance, inflation rates, and the political climate. What is Jordanian Dinar (JOD)

The Jordanian Dinar (JOD) is the official currency of Jordan, introduced in 1950. It is subdivided into 10 dirhams, 100 qirsh, or 1000 fils. The symbol for the Jordanian Dinar is د.أ (Arabic script) or JD in English. The currency’s ISO code is JOD, and it is issued by the Central Bank of Jordan.

The Jordanian Dinar is considered one of the more stable currencies in the Middle East, and its value is pegged to the US Dollar (USD). This peg means that the Jordanian government commits to maintaining a fixed exchange rate with the USD, which helps stabilize the economy.
